Maciej Szymczak

Full Professor of Business Administration, Institute of International Business and Economics, Department of Logistics, Poznań University of Economics and Business (PUEB), Poznań, Poland.

Professor M. Szymczak received M.Sc. degree in the area of Computer Science from the Technical University of Poznan, Ph.D. and post Ph.D. (habilitation) degree in the area of Business Administration, majoring in business logistics management, from PUEB.

His research focuses on business logistics, international logistics and supply chain management, information systems for logistics, and city logistics. He has published over 120 articles in professional journals. He is author and co-author or editor of 18 books. He has lectured and taught logistics at many universities and business schools in the region. He is a member of the editorial board of scientific journals and business magazines, member of the scientific committee of numerous international conferences and the reviewer of presented papers. Professor M. Szymczak has over twenty years’ experience as a consultant to many companies and local government on logistics matters. He took an active part in various business projects. He is recipient of 21 PUEB Rector’s Awards.

At his alma mater, he held administrative positions for 18 years, being vice-dean, dean and then vice-rector.
